If you are experiencing technical difficulties, please try the following:

  • ensure that you are on the HCPSS issued Chromebook.

  • close the browser completely and re-open.

  • make sure that your child is logged in with HCPSS credentials.

  • restart the Chromebook and try again.

 

If you can’t enter a Google Meet and see a message that you can’t start the meeting, that means that the teacher has not yet opened the Meet. Please try again about two minutes before the start of the class.
